La Paz County Incident Reports Public Records — Key Highlights

La Paz County is the 15th county in the U.S. State of Arizona, located in the western part of the state. As of the 2020 census, its population was 16,557, making it the second-least populous county in Arizona.

The name of the county is the Spanish word for 'the peace', and is taken from the early settlement of La Paz along the Colorado River.
